  1. Of course not, football is a TEAM sport with 22 guys on the field at the same time. Wrestling is an individual act with your points going to a team score. In wrestling you could wrestle a bigger school at least for the fact that everyone's gonna get a match. Why would you want to wrestle another small school that possibly has forfeits in weight classes where you have kids? Where does it end with "class wrestling"? Do you not wrestle small schools like Delphi or Union County because they have studs that would pulverize the kids in their weight classes on your team?
